We conducted a dendrochronology study in the Greater Caucasus region of Georgia to elucidate relationship between tree growth and specific climatic variables including temperature (mean, minimum, maximum), precipitation, streamflow, reconstruct paleohydrology Kura River assess impacts climate change on water resources. analyzed tree-ring chronologies from 1720 2021, high correlation coefficients (e.g., EPS= 0.985) demonstrate consistency data. The article describes and interprets the results of a study aimed at studying public opinion about activities national parks. attitude local population to State Institution “National Park Tajikistan” was studied. A total 40 respondents from residents were surveyed. Fifteen Khorog, most them educated people, students Khorog University teachers Biological Institute Pamirs who are familiar with Tajik National in vicinity have carried out several scientific studies.
